An edited volume on the doctrine of providence from a variety of biblical, historical, and dogmatic perspectives.

About the author










Justin Stratis is Tutor in Christian Doctrine and Director of Postgraduate Research at Trinity College Bristol, UK.

Tim Harmon is Adjunct Lecturer in Theology at Western Seminary in Portland, USA.
